Hey,

I wonder if anyone ever wanted to create his own theme in t68. It's easy, you send a theme to your email, check it with a hex editor, and will find an XML inside where the colours can be altered, and also the binary gif images are included there. I'll make my own brownish theme today, but want to be able to download lots of themes as I can do with background images.

roadrunner Posts: 26

steps:
-set up e-mail in the phone so that you can send emails. You need a mail account from your operator, or a free email service that lets you send via smtp from everywhere. Rare, hotpop works fine for me.
-go to themes, highlight one, option button, send, via email
-check the .thm file you receive to your mailbox
-if you take a closer look with a hex editor, you'll find something in the middle like this (note that it is xml, not html):
























































































-edit the color values
-send back to the phone. now this can be tricky, you can't send back in email, 'cause you can't access the attached .thm. There are sendfile utilities out there for t68, or it can be sent via MMS.
